Android编程入门教程:开放手机联盟详解

需积分: 32 4 下载量 114 浏览量 更新于2024-07-24 收藏 7.98MB PDF 举报
"Android开发教程,这是一份三百多页的经典教程,适合初学者入门,涵盖了Android编程的基础知识,包括开放手机联盟的介绍及其成员。" Android开发是移动应用开发领域的重要部分,尤其对于想要构建安卓应用程序的开发者而言,掌握Android的基本概念和技术至关重要。这份"Android开发教程"是一个理想的起点,它提供了丰富的学习材料,帮助新手逐步了解和掌握Android平台的开发技能。 首先,教程可能介绍了Android编程的基础,包括Android Studio集成开发环境的使用、Android SDK的安装与配置、以及如何创建第一个Hello World应用程序。这些基础知识对于任何Android开发者来说都是必不可少的。通过实践这些基本操作,开发者能够建立起对Android开发环境的理解。 其次,教程可能会深入讲解Android应用程序的结构,如Activity、Intent、Service、BroadcastReceiver和ContentProvider等核心组件。这些组件是Android应用程序功能实现的关键,理解它们的工作原理和交互方式是提升开发能力的重要步骤。 此外,Android UI设计也是教程中的重要部分,可能会涵盖XML布局的创建、各种控件的使用,以及Material Design设计规范的应用。这对于创建用户友好的应用程序界面至关重要。 开放手机联盟(Open Handset Alliance)的介绍,则揭示了Android操作系统背后的力量。这个由Google主导的联盟集合了众多硬件制造商、芯片供应商和运营商,共同推动Android系统的开放性和创新性。了解其成员和目标,可以帮助开发者理解Android生态系统的特点和优势。 教程中还可能涉及Android的版本迭代历史,每一代Android系统的新特性和改进,这对于开发者保持与时俱进,适应不同设备和用户需求非常重要。同时,Android的权限管理系统、数据存储、网络通信、多媒体处理、通知管理等内容也会被详细讲解。 最后,对于初学者,教程可能还会提供调试技巧、性能优化建议以及如何将应用发布到Google Play Store的流程。这些都是开发者在实际项目中需要掌握的实用技能。 这份"Android开发教程"为初学者提供了一个全面的学习路径,从基础知识到实践应用,从理论概念到行业动态,覆盖了Android开发的多个层面,是学习Android开发的宝贵资源。通过深入学习和实践,开发者能够逐步建立起自己的Android开发能力,并为未来的职业发展打下坚实的基础。